Hi all, I just experimented with some entries for the Su-39 I added this to the Data.ini

// Recon Cam -------------------

 

[ReconCam1]

ReferenceName=

SystemType=EO_CAMERA

CameraFOV=40.000000

CameraPosition=0.000000,10.062,-0.956

CameraYaw=15.000000

CameraPitch=15.000000

CameraRoll=15.000000

SightTexture=avq23sight1.tga

EODisplayFlags=268435456

 

[ReconCam2]

ReferenceName=

SystemType=EO_CAMERA

CameraFOV=15.000000

CameraPosition=0.000000,10.062,-0.956

CameraYaw=15.000000

CameraPitch=15.000000

CameraRoll=15.000000

SightTexture=avq23sight1.tga

EODisplayFlags=268435456

 

but only one of them works, how can I make them all to work so you can switch between them to simulate a "zoom"?????

only one EO Camera works, be it onbord or in form of a dropable recon pod, at least that's what mky limited testing concluded. You can fake more cams by adding them as weapons on individual stations. At least a LGB and the EO camera system work. In general discussion used to be a thread about it. Recon cams for RF-4C

 

Second:

 

[ReconCam1]

ReferenceName=

SystemType=EO_CAMERA

CameraFOV=40.000000

CameraPosition=0.000000,10.062,-0.956

CameraYaw=15.000000

CameraPitch=15.000000

CameraRoll=15.000000 these are not referenced for onboard systems!

SightTexture=avq23sight1.tga

EODisplayFlags=268435456

 

CameraAngles=0.0,-70.0,0.0 use this format instead: Values (-left + right , -down +up , -left +right roll?)

 

That's for SFP patched to OCT2008 level,

not sure about SFP2
